Canvas Seat Covers For Chevrolet Colorado For 2008-2012 Dual Cab | GreyMade From Polyester Canvas These Seat Covers Are At The Lower End Of The Market And Ideal For The Consumer Who Does Not Want To Spend Too Much. Water Resistant, Machine Washable And With A 12 Month Workmanship Warranty They Are Also Air Bag Compatible. Seat Covers Are Available In Either Black Or Grey Colours And In Universal Fronts And Rears. Tailor Made Off The Shelf Packs Are Also Available In A Number Of Vehicles.
